Im not sure if this is in the right forum but if not please tell me so i can move it... anyways i was wondering what are things i can do to a car that will still let me pass inspections? Like the exhaust suspensions etc... also is it illegal to have the corner lights and signal/bumper lights taken off?

im not sure if im calling them correctly - the ones that are at the corner of the bumper or the side and its very thin not the headlight itself

Exhaust and suspension shouldn't be a problem, but all the correct signalling lights should be put back on, at least for the inspection. If the lights were never stock in the first place (like side markers on a car that never had them in the first place) that's fine, but you should check local regulations on exterior lighting.

I know that side markers would be fine here, but if you have xenon bulbs or those weird windshield washer fluid squirter lights you'll never pass inspection where I live (Nova Scotia).
